#011c50 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#011c50 is composed of 0.4% red, 11%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 98.8% cyan, 65% magenta, 0% yellow and 68.6% black. It has a hue angle of 219.5 degrees, a saturation of 97.5% and a lightness of 15.9%. #011c50 color hex could be obtained by blending #0238a0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003366.

Shades and Tints of #011c50
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000103 is the darkest color, while #eef4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#011c50
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#26282b is the less saturated color, while #011c50 is the most saturated one.
